The wine region formerly known as Burgundy is making a bold move to reclaim its original French name, Bourgogne. This decision, driven by a desire to reaffirm regional identity, speaks to a larger trend in the luxury and lifestyle sectors where authenticity and cultural heritage are increasingly valued.
The arrival of the WSET, the world's leading wine qualification, in Beaune further underscores Bourgogne's commitment to education and global influence in the wine industry.
